Edvard Munch: Trembling Earth at Munch (Oslo, Norway)

*Dates:* April 27 – August 25, 2024

*Location:* Munch Museum, Oslo, Norway

Why is it Celebrated?

The “Trembling Earth” exhibition is a tribute to Edvard Munch’s profound connection with nature. This event celebrates Munch’s unique ability to capture the raw and often unsettling beauty of the natural world. His work reflects the emotional resonance and symbolic power of landscapes, seascapes, and other natural phenomena.

History of the Event

The Munch Museum regularly curates exhibitions to explore various facets of Edvard Munch’s oeuvre. “Trembling Earth” is one such event, focusing specifically on his fascination with nature. By bringing together works from the museum’s own collection and private collections, the exhibition aims to provide a comprehensive look at how Munch’s environment influenced his art over the decades.

Event Details

The exhibition will feature iconic paintings, drawings, and prints by Munch, showcasing his evolving relationship with nature. Visitors will have the opportunity to see famous works like “The Scream,” “The Sun,” and “Starry Night” alongside lesser-known pieces that reveal his deep contemplation of the natural world.
